Purpose of the role
The Estimator’s role is to support the Pre Construction Manager in preparing estimates for civil engineering and building works for Electricity Transmission Substations and High Voltage Direct Current Interconnector Convertor stations in accordance with company bidding/estimating systems and procedures.
Working predominantly with the Pre Construction Manager, but liaising with other members of tendering & engineering teams as deemed appropriate according to the specific tender, to develop customer and company requirements to secure value solutions in support of the wider tender to meet the company's objectives.
Responsibilities
- Produce take-offs and bills of quantities adhering to CESSM4 for civil enabling works, civil, structural and architectural packages
- Produce elemental cost plans for business development and budget submissions
- Strong working knowledge of estimating software
- Strong working knowledge of MS Excel
- Undertake estimates in accordance with Company procedures for the Civil Engineering, Building and Building Services works
- Identify and record opportunity and risk during tender process
- Maintain register of assumptions within estimate
- Produce detailed exclusions, assumptions and qualifications for tender
